Bradford Literature Festival is an annual arts event and year-round cultural outreach programme that hosts renowned authors, poets, speakers, musicians and artists from Bradford, the UK and around the world. Founded in 2014, BLF is a key event in the UK cultural calendar and the most diverse literature festival in the country.

A young festival, BLF has grown rapidly in size and popularity. The festival takes place annually over 10-days at the end of June and the start of July, with a programme of over 700+ events stretching from the heart of the city and across the district. BLF’s signature mix of topic-led events, which include author talks, world-class poetry line-ups, live music, film, theatre and more, attract more than 70,000 people to Bradford each year.
